Output aa8d56b72174d06f4f293cc503cc28adbd429a972581cc56aa38ef057fcf9c25:0

value
41596930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ce1fa8f794fa39c2897db9a5b1e55d24a0968ec1 OP_EQUAL
address
3LUu3qZgFT6GLbc1RxLnouk6hePcDPU5Zm
transaction
aa8d56b72174d06f4f293cc503cc28adbd429a972581cc56aa38ef057fcf9c25
confirmations
353406
spent
true